If there are dips in the roadway or if i have my small utility trailer my tj acts like it is on a cartoon ACME spring way to much travel needs to have stiffer springs or something you guys are up on this i don't want it lifted and it is all original 97sahara 4.0 no mods .. What do i need?
 
Shocks. Bet yours are shot.

You could try the football trick...stuff them inside the springs and use them as overload airbags. Adjust pressure as needed.

-Mac
 
X3. it sounds solely like your shock absorbers are worn out. A good riding mid-priced shock absorber is the Rancho RS5000x. Shocks are easily replaced on a TJ if you are mechanically inclined, you don't even need to jack it up to replace them. You just need a ratchet wrench and a couple smaller wrenches.
